General Description

R-2-Aminononanoic acid, also known as R-2-aminononanoate or R-2-aminononanoic acid, is an organic compound with the chemical formula C9H19NO2. It is a carboxylic acid that contains a primary amine functional group and a nonanoic acid chain. This chemical is commonly used as an intermediate in the synthesis of pharmaceuticals and agrochemicals. It has also been studied for its potential applications in the production of biodegradable polymers. R-2-Aminononanoic acid has various industrial uses and is an important building block in organic chemistry. Additionally, it has potential applications in the field of medicine and biotechnology due to its unique chemical properties.

Check Digit Verification of cas no

The CAS Registry Mumber 81177-55-1 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 8,1,1,7 and 7 respectively; the second part has 2 digits, 5 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 81177-55:
(7*8)+(6*1)+(5*1)+(4*7)+(3*7)+(2*5)+(1*5)=131
131 % 10 = 1
So 81177-55-1 is a valid CAS Registry Number.
